summ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Roland McGrath <roland@gnu.org>2006-02-01 19:45:29 +0000
committerRoland McGrath <roland@gnu.org>2006-02-01 19:45:29 +0000
commitd36421fa255cdd931c18ad03cfda435e7897ef10 (patch)
tree96984558162d343e581c0111e619b240e9661b43
parent9d4c4f44768afda6f527c35959fbf339c508a035 (diff)
* math/bits/mathcalls.h: Guard __END_NAMESPACE_C99 with the
same #if condition as corresponding __BEGIN_NAMESPACE_C99. (scalb): Don't define only if __USE_ISOC99.
-rw-r--r--ChangeLog4
-rw-r--r--math/bits/mathcalls.h9
2 files changed, 10 insertions, 3 deletions
diff --git a/ChangeLog b/ChangeLog
index d0d6db4c36..019c3a8ace 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,5 +1,9 @@
2006-02-01 Jakub Jelinek <jakub@redhat.com>
+ * math/bits/mathcalls.h: Guard __END_NAMESPACE_C99 with the
+ same #if condition as corresponding __BEGIN_NAMESPACE_C99.
+ (scalb): Don't define only if __USE_ISOC99.
+
* sysdeps/ieee754/ldbl-128/s_llrintl.c (__llrintl): Fix a typo.
* sysdeps/s390/fpu/libm-test-ulps: Remove llrint ulps.
diff --git a/math/bits/mathcalls.h b/math/bits/mathcalls.h
index 174fe34589..64da6276f6 100644
--- a/math/bits/mathcalls.h
+++ b/math/bits/mathcalls.h
@@ -353,10 +353,13 @@ __MATHDECL_1 (int, __signbit,, (_Mdouble_ __value))
/* Multiply-add function computed as a ternary operation. */
__MATHCALL (fma,, (_Mdouble_ __x, _Mdouble_ __y, _Mdouble_ __z));
+#endif /* Use ISO C99. */
+
+#if defined __USE_MISC || defined __USE_XOPEN_EXTENDED || defined __USE_ISOC99
__END_NAMESPACE_C99
+#endif
-# if defined __USE_MISC || defined __USE_XOPEN_EXTENDED
+#if defined __USE_MISC || defined __USE_XOPEN_EXTENDED
/* Return X times (2 to the Nth power). */
__MATHCALL (scalb,, (_Mdouble_ __x, _Mdouble_ __n));
-# endif
-#endif /* Use ISO C99. */
+#endif